摘要
An efficient synthesis of indolizine derivatives by palladium-catalyzed oxidative carbonylation of propargylic pyridines has been developed. The reaction can be conducted at room temperature and under 3 bar of CO in the presence of Pd-2(dba)(3) or Pd/C. The catalyst Pd/C could be easily removed from the reaction and recycled.
